Marco Rubio discussed Ukraine with his European colleagues
![]() 299 Tuesday, 26 August, 2025, 10:06 US Secretary of State Marco Rubio discussed the diplomatic settlement of the conflict in Ukraine with the foreign ministers of Finland, France, Germany, Italy, Poland, the UK and Ukraine, as well as the head of European diplomacy, the US State Department reported. The parties “agreed to continue diplomatic efforts aimed at achieving a long-term end to the Russian-Ukrainian war through negotiations,” the statement said. CNN notes that Rubio “discussed the work of the coalition with the foreign ministers of Europe and Ukraine to create possible security guarantees for Ukraine.” Ukrainian Minister Andriy Sibikhan confirmed on the social network X that Kiev is ready for “next steps towards peace” and “meetings at the level of leaders in any format,” the channel’s publication says. |
